

Snyk and Splunk ITSI operate in the software security and IT service intelligence domains, respectively. Snyk appears to have a strong emphasis on comprehensive security measures and ease of integration, while Splunk ITSI excels in detailed data analytics and visualization capabilities.
Features: Snyk offers robust integrations with development tools, container security features, and a reliable vulnerability database, making it accessible for developers. Splunk ITSI provides powerful data ingestion, real-time service health monitoring, and proactive trend identification, benefiting companies with its sophisticated analytics and extensive visualization tools.
Room for Improvement: Snyk could expand its security scanning options by including SAST/DAST and enhance its multilingual support. It also requires improvements in visibility, accuracy, and interoperability with other tools. Splunk ITSI might develop better integration and customization options for its dashboards, and make its predictive analytics more user-friendly.
Ease of Deployment and Customer Service: Snyk offers flexible cloud deployments with responsive, developer-focused support and straightforward documentation, resulting in a smooth implementation process. Splunk ITSI provides robust multi-cloud capabilities but may pose deployment challenges, needing technical expertise. However, it compensates by offering comprehensive technical support.
Pricing and ROI: Snyk is noted for its flexible pricing tiers that cater to different usage levels, promising a rapid realization of value particularly in security assurance. In contrast, Splunk ITSI's pricing, based on data ingestion, is often viewed as expensive. Still, its extensive monitoring and analytics can justify the costs for enterprises requiring deep insights and effective integration.

Our integration of Snyk into GitHub allows us to automatically scan codebases and identify issues, which has improved efficiency.
Snyk helps detect vulnerabilities before code moves to production, allowing for integration with DevOps and providing a shift-left advantage by identifying and fixing bugs before deployment.
Snyk has positively impacted my organization by improving the security posture across all software repositories, resulting in fewer critical vulnerabilities, more confidence in overall product security, and faster security compliance for project clients.
The predictive analysis can give you proactive information about potential bottlenecks that can occur on applications, desk, storage, SQL servers, databases, or other systems.
One valuable feature is the scheduled maintenance window provided by Splunk ITSI (IT Service Intelligence) because Splunk does not offer this scheduling maintenance feature in the core product, but Splunk ITSI (IT Service Intelligence) helps us with these maintenance reports.
Splunk ITSI allows for integration with threat intelligence, enabling my organization to correlate more than two events for generating alerts.

Splunk IT Service Intelligence (ITSI) is a powerful analytics-driven monitoring and analytics solution that provides real-time insights into the health and performance of IT services.
It enables organizations to proactively identify and resolve issues, optimize service delivery, and improve overall IT operations. With its advanced machine learning capabilities, ITSI automatically detects anomalies, predicts future events, and prioritizes alerts based on business impact.
The solution offers a centralized view of IT services, allowing users to visualize and analyze data from multiple sources in a single dashboard. ITSI also provides customizable KPIs, service-level agreements (SLAs), and key performance indicators (KPIs) to measure and track service performance.
